When's the best time for a beach holiday in Black Mountain?
You can plan your beach trip with a look at year-round temperatures in Black Mountain: The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 21°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 5°C. Average annual precipitation for Black Mountain is 1386 mm.
What is there to see and do around Black Mountain?
After getting settled at your accommodation of choice, you'll likely want to venture out and explore. Experience the area's live music and hiking trails, and make time for local attractions such as Lake Tomahawk and Catawba Falls. You can also pay a visit to Pisgah National Forest or Mount Mitchell State Park for more to see and do.
What's the best way to get to my beach hotel in Black Mountain?
Here's some information to help you get to and around your beach accommodation in Black Mountain more easily: To get to Black Mountain, book a flight to Asheville Regional Airport (AVL), the closest major airport, which is located 17.5 mi (28.2 km) from the city centre. If you'd like to venture out around the area, you may want to rent a car for your trip.
